Answer:
sand = 3450 pounds
3/4 inch stones =6750 pounds
1 inch stones =4800 pounds.
Step-by-step explanation:
The mixture composition is :
45% three-quarter inch stones
32% inch stones and
sand for balance
The percent here is by mass of material used.
Weight of mixture is 15,000 pounds before oil addition.
Use the percent by weight for the two types of stones and calculate real values in pounds
Formula to apply is:
Mass percent = (mass of a material/ total mass of mixture) * 100
For 3/4 inch stones it will be:

The 3/4 inch stones weigh 6750 pounds
The 1 inch stones will be

The 1 inch stones weigh = 4800 pounds
Total for the two items : 4800+6750 =11550 pounds
The sand used weighs : 15000 - 11550 = 3450 pounds

Answer:
Statement 3
Step-by-step explanation:
<u>Statement 1:</u> For any positive integer n, the square root of n is irrational.
Suppose n = 25 (25 is positive integer), then

Since 5 is rational number, this statement is false.
<u>Statement 2:</u> If n is a positive integer, the square root of n is rational.
Suppose n = 8 (8 is positive integer), then

Since
is irrational number, this statement is false.
<u>Statement 3:</u> If n is a positive integer, the square root of n is rational if and only if n is a perfect square.
If n is a positive integer and square root of n is rational, then n is a perfect square.
If n is a positive integer and n is a perfect square, then square root of n is a rational number.
This statement is true.
